ADB MCP
A Model Context Protocol (MCP) server that provides Android Debug Bridge (ADB) functionality for automating Android devices.
Features
Device Management
- List connected devices
- Get device information
- Set default device for operations
- Check device connection status
Screen Operations
- Take screenshots
- Click at coordinates
- Swipe gestures
- Input text
- Press keys
App Management
- Install/uninstall apps
- Start/stop apps
- List installed apps
- Get app information
File Operations
- Push files to device
- Pull files from device
- List files and directories
- Create directories
- Delete files
Shell Commands
- Execute shell commands
- Get system information
- Get battery information
- Get logcat output

Usage
Prerequisites
- Android Debug Bridge (adb) must be installed and available in PATH
- Android device connected via USB with USB debugging enabled
- Device must be authorized for debugging
Running the Server
npm start
Available Tools
Device Management
adb_list_devices- List all connected devicesadb_get_device_info- Get device informationadb_set_default_device- Set default device
Screen Operations
adb_screenshot- Take screenshotadb_click- Click at coordinatesadb_swipe- Swipe gestureadb_input_text- Input textadb_press_key- Press key
App Management
adb_install_app- Install APKadb_uninstall_app- Uninstall appadb_start_app- Start appadb_stop_app- Stop appadb_list_apps- List installed apps
File Operations
adb_push_file- Push file to deviceadb_pull_file- Pull file from deviceadb_list_files- List files in directory
Shell Commands
adb_shell- Execute shell commandadb_get_system_info- Get system informationadb_get_battery_info- Get battery informationadb_get_logcat- Get logcat output
Security
The server includes basic security measures:
- Dangerous shell commands are blocked
- File path validation
- Device connection verification
- Input sanitization
